Job Description
Job Summary Oversees the daily activities and management of Imaging Services in order to ensure the delivery of quality patient care. Performs a variety of administrative duties and monitors the technical aspects of patient procedures and equipment operations. Responsibilities Structures staff work assignments to achieve high levels of efficiency. Structures and assigns departmental work in a planned, systematic manner. Conducts monthly staff meetings. Establishes challenging and measurable goals that are aligned with corporate strategic goals and objectives. Delegates assignments effectively and appropriately. Actively participates as a member of the management team; shares information appropriately, returns calls promptly and constructively contributes to committees and teams. Prepares sound budget projections in a thorough, accurate manner that supports departmental goals and objectives. Assesses all aspects of a project and establishes appropriate and achievable deadlines based on thorough research. Effectively and appropriately organizes and manages both long-term goals and projects, as well as short-term daily workflow in order to meet project deadlines.
Knowledge, Skills & Abilities Light Work:
Frequent lifting and/or carrying of objects weighing up to 10 lbs. with a maximum lifting of 25 lbs. 5-10 years of experience as a Technologist. At least 3 years in a management role. Demonstrated ability to plan and administer departmental goals and objectives, prepare and initiate marketing and promotional strategies, research and negotiate for state-of-the-art equipment, and investigate and recommend procedures and techniques for the professional and technical staff. Supervisory experience normally acquired through at least three years previous experience in a managerial capacity with technical and supervisory responsibilities. Knowledge of general finance and accounting procedures and personnel practices as normally acquired through completion of college level business courses or previous managerial experience. Communication and interpersonal skills needed to deal effectively with administration, medical personnel, all staff and patients. Negotiation skills needed to deal with vendors effectively. Education Associate's Degree (required) Bachelor's Degree preferred Credentials Amer Registry of Rad Techs (Required) Radiologic Technologist (Required) Basic Cardiac Life Support (Required)Work Schedule:
